Ontario is one of the busiest communities in the Inland Empire, with events and attractions drawing folks from all over southern California as well as locals. The city is a popular shopping destination, specifically the enormous Ontario Mills shopping mall. Next door to Ontario Mills, Citizens Business Bank Arena plays host to concerts and sporting events throughout the year, regularly drawing crowds of up to 11,000 people. Both of these attractions sit on the northeast corner of Ontario, as does the popular Cucamonga-Guasti Regional Park. Metrolink service connects Ontario to Riverside in the east (30 minutes) and Los Angeles in the west (roughly one hour).
